EWT - Hand and Portable Power Tools

Learning objectives

  • Identify safety standards for cord- and-plug-connected equipment.
  • Recognize safe practices for working with portable and vehicle-mounted generators.
  • Explain how to safely use and maintain hydraulic and pneumatic tools.
  • Define quality assurance practices for live-line tools.

Course overview

The goal of this lesson is to provide awareness training for electrical workers about safe procedures for working with portable cord-and-plug-connected power tools and equipment, hydraulic and pneumatic power tools, live-line tools, and the requirements for maintaining them.
